+// Check XML tags and fix discontinuous case, for example:
+//
+// <row r="15" spans="1:22" x14ac:dyDescent="0.2">
+// <c r="A15" s="2" />
+// <c r="B15" s="2" />
+// <c r="F15" s="1" />
+// <c r="G15" s="1" />
+// </row>
+//
+// in this case, we should to change it to
+//
+// <row r="15" spans="1:22" x14ac:dyDescent="0.2">
+// <c r="A15" s="2" />
+// <c r="B15" s="2" />
+// <c r="C15" s="2" />
+// <c r="D15" s="2" />
+// <c r="E15" s="2" />
+// <c r="F15" s="1" />
+// <c r="G15" s="1" />
+// </row>
+//
+func checkRow(xlsx xlsxWorksheet) xlsxWorksheet {
+ for k, v := range xlsx.SheetData.Row {
+ lenCol := len(v.C)
+ endR := getColIndex(v.C[lenCol-1].R)
+ endRow := getRowIndex(v.C[lenCol-1].R)
+ endCol := titleToNumber(endR)
+ if lenCol < endCol {
+ oldRow := xlsx.SheetData.Row[k].C
+ xlsx.SheetData.Row[k].C = xlsx.SheetData.Row[k].C[:0]
+ tmp := []xlsxC{}
+ for i := 0; i <= endCol; i++ {
+ fixAxis := toAlphaString(i+1) + strconv.Itoa(endRow)
+ tmp = append(tmp, xlsxC{
+ R: fixAxis,
+ })
+ }
+ xlsx.SheetData.Row[k].C = tmp
+ for _, y := range oldRow {
+ colAxis := titleToNumber(getColIndex(y.R))
+ xlsx.SheetData.Row[k].C[colAxis] = y
+ }
+ }
+ }
+ return xlsx
+}
